    SW13 covers Barnes and Mortlake in southwest London, sitting on the Thames within the London boroughs of Richmond and Wandsworth. These riverside neighbourhoods are characterised by village-like charm, strong community identity, and appeal to affluent families and professionals seeking space and green amenities.
